“Blended Learning” is a term that describes a 21st Century Classroom where students and teachers have access to the Internet through devices, whether they be Chromebooks, iPads, laptops or cell phones. In the Blended Classroom, teachers and students use the tool that is best for the students’ learning whether the right tool is technology centered or paper based.
Blended Learning Strategy 1 DON’T STEAL THE LEARNING
When you are planning, ask yourself, “What will my STUDENTS be doing?” Maximize the work of the students and minimize your work. Creating opportunities for student choice will increase motivation and allow you to focus your work on areas that help students learn most.
